HEC Paris MBA Admission Requirements: A Detailed Breakdown
Now, let’s get down to the nitty-gritty. The HEC Paris MBA admissions process is rigorous and holistic, evaluating candidates based on a variety of factors. Here’s a detailed breakdown of the key requirements:
1. Academic Transcripts
You’ll need to submit official transcripts from all undergraduate and graduate institutions you’ve attended. These transcripts should demonstrate a strong academic record. While there’s no minimum GPA requirement, successful applicants typically have a GPA above 3.0 (or its equivalent). However, a lower GPA can be compensated for by strong performance in other areas of your application, such as your GMAT/GRE score and work experience.
The admissions committee will be looking for consistency in your academic performance and any evidence of upward trends. If you had a particularly challenging semester or year, be sure to address it in your optional essay. Explain the circumstances and how you overcame them.
2. GMAT/GRE Score
The GMAT (Graduate Management Admission Test) or GRE (Graduate Record Examinations) is a standardized test that assesses your analytical, quantitative, verbal, and writing skills. While HEC Paris doesn’t have a minimum score requirement, the average GMAT score for admitted students is around 690. For the GRE, a score above 320 is generally considered competitive. However, remember that these are just averages. A lower score can be offset by other strengths in your application.

3. Work Experience
HEC Paris values candidates with significant professional experience. The average work experience for admitted students is around 6 years. However, the admissions committee is more interested in the quality and impact of your work experience than the quantity. They want to see that you’ve taken on increasing levels of responsibility, demonstrated leadership potential, and made meaningful contributions to your organization.
Highlighting Your Work Experience: In your application, be sure to clearly articulate your accomplishments and the impact you’ve had in your previous roles.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to describe your experiences in a concise and impactful way. Quantify your achievements whenever possible. For example, instead of saying “I improved marketing campaigns,” say “I improved marketing campaigns, resulting in a 15% increase in lead generation.”

6. English Proficiency
If English is not your native language, you’ll need to demonstrate your English proficiency by submitting scores from the TOEFL, IELTS, or PTE Academic. HEC Paris requires a minimum TOEFL score of 100, an IELTS score of 7.0, or a PTE Academic score of 73. Make sure to check the HEC Paris website for the most up-to-date requirements.

7. Application Fee
You’ll need to pay an application fee to submit your application. The fee is typically around €200. Make sure to check the HEC Paris website for the exact amount and payment instructions.
8. Interview
If your application is successful, you’ll be invited to interview with a member of the HEC Paris admissions committee. The interview is an opportunity for the admissions committee to get to know you better and assess your fit with the HEC Paris community. The interview typically lasts around 45 minutes and can be conducted in person or via Skype.

Financing Your HEC Paris MBA
Financing an MBA is a significant investment, and it’s important to explore all your options. The HEC Paris MBA offers a number of financial aid options to help students finance their education.
Scholarships
HEC Paris offers a variety of scholarships to talented and deserving students. Scholarships are typically awarded based on academic merit, leadership potential, and financial need. Some scholarships are specifically targeted at students from certain countries or industries.
Loans
HEC Paris also partners with a number of lenders to provide students with access to loans. These loans can help you cover the cost of tuition, fees, and living expenses. It’s important to shop around and compare interest rates and terms before choosing a loan.
